Poisons work in a manner similar to alchemy, yep. Right now animals aren't used, but animal parts will later be introduced, I'm sure. Possibly before release, possibly not.
Poisons are made using a number of poisonous plants prepared in a manner that makes it most effective, for example, dedlas seeds are crushed and pressed to extract dedlas oil, or imfel seeds are crushed and boiled, and the crystals they leave behind, imfel crystals, are used in poisons.
Poisons require many components alchemy does not and vice versa, but use a similar process and tools.
Applications will be weapons, food, drink, traps, arrows, not sure on bullets yet, but it seems reasonable.

<grin> Na, it'll be much more balanced than that. Poison isn't only for damage either, there are many "debuff" poisons that will lower stats, increase the target's RT, etc.
I had considered giving one of the professions poison resistance as a bonus <grin>. I'm sure there will be a number of defense options for poisons, you just have to actively choose to use 'em.
